The British Embassy to the Department of State

Memorandum

His Majesty’s Government have received official notification of the constitution of a National Polish Committee the seat of which is to be Paris.

The committee propose to undertake:

1.
The representation of Polish interests in Great Britain, the United States and Italy and any other country in which Polish interests may render this necessary;
2.
To deal with political questions arising out of the recent constitution of a Polish Army to fight on the side of the Allies;
3.
The protection of persons of Polish nationality in Allied countries.

Among the members of the committee are Piltz, Seyda, Sobanski, Zamoyski and Paderewski.

[Page 762]

His Majesty’s Government are inclined officially to recognize this committee but would be glad of the views of the United States Government on the proposal, before they take any action, in view of a recent suggestion by the United States Ambassador at London that His Majesty’s Government should recognize a Polish provisional government in the United States.
